Haunted Homes In Demand

Published / Last Updated on 06/11/2005

While people used to go to great lengths to ward off evil spirits, hanging horseshoes and charms or employing priests to ward off demons, research from Portman has found that these days, most people wouldn't be put off buying a house if it was rumoured to be haunted! 

One in three people claim to have lived in a house that was either haunted or rumoured to be haunted!  It seems that most people who live in the UK don't mind the extra guests, but if buyers found out that the previous owner had died there, they would want the price of the property to be lowered, while eighty two per cent would purchase a property that was number 13 in the road, and 37% would even buy a house if it had a nasty history or a grave yard underneath!

If it did turn out that a property was haunted, almost half of the people surveyed would stay in their home, while 24% say they would stay put, but hire an exorcist to get rid of the ghosts!
